正则表达式的性能可能不如 bytes.Replace,因此在处理大量文本时需要注意性能问题。
本教程旨在详细讲解如何在python中根据一个列表的元素对另一个相关联的列表进行重排和分组。
第二个示例展示了当分隔符位于流的末尾时,它会正确地返回分隔符之前的数据。
字符与字符串的转换 Go语言提供了将 byte 和 rune 转换为字符串的方法: byte 转字符串: 使用 string(byte) 将单个 byte 转换为字符串。
可以使用 Pandas 的 merge() 函数来实现这个目标。
技术博客与专栏:掘金、SegmentFault等平台有开发者分享JWT、微服务等实战经验,结合代码示例,解决具体问题很有效。
虚函数调用会带来一定的性能损耗,因为它需要在运行时确定要调用的函数。
<?php // 方法一:使用完整命名空间 $controller = new \MyApp\Controllers\UserController(); $controller->index(); // 方法二:使用 use 简化 use MyApp\Controllers\UserController; $controller = new UserController(); $controller->index(); 子命名空间与层级结构 命名空间支持层级结构,使用反斜杠 \ 分隔层级,通常对应项目的目录结构。
这意味着你不能仅仅通过value是否为零值来判断键是否存在,因为一个存在的键也可能恰好存储了零值。
我们将阐明asyncio.gather()用于并发执行的特性,并提供一种确保任务按严格顺序完成的方法,即通过逐一await来解决数据依赖性场景下的挑战。
然而,有时除了表单数据,我们还需要传递一些不在表单内的额外JavaScript变量。
如果在数据导入过程中或之前执行,后续的显式ID插入仍可能再次导致序列脱节。
立即学习“go语言免费学习笔记(深入)”; 测试期望发生 panic 的情况 某些场景下,你希望函数在非法输入时主动panic,这时可用recover配合defer来捕获并验证。
头插法和尾插法:头插效率高(O(1)),尾插需要遍历(O(n))。
本文探讨了Python csv.writer 在生成CSV文件时出现额外空白行的常见问题及其解决方案。
Memcached 更轻量,纯内存操作,适合简单键值缓存。
在Go语言中,值类型通过指针传递可修改原始变量,需使用&取地址、*解引用,结构体指针访问字段时自动解引用。
这种模式是 Go 语言中处理后台任务和并发循环的常见且推荐的方法,它简洁高效,并能很好地融入 Go 的并发模型。
基本上就这些。
这有助于检测连接是否仍然活跃,即使没有业务数据传输。
本文链接:http://www.douglasjamesguitar.com/315827_93548d.html